The Sanctuary of Truth in Pattaya is an awe-inspiring all-wood temple-like structure intricately carved with Hindu and Buddhist motifs. Its main purpose is to serve as a philosophical reflection on ancient knowledge, Eastern philosophy, and the importance of religion, life, and the universe. It symbolizes the cycle of life, the pursuit of truth, and the universal connection between humanity and nature, built to preserve and highlight traditional Thai craftsmanship and spiritual values.
The Sanctuary of Truth is entirely constructed from wood, without using any metal nails, showcasing extraordinary traditional Thai craftsmanship. Visitors can observe intricate carvings of deities, mythological creatures, and philosophical symbols representing Eastern religious and cultural beliefs. The design blends elements of Ayutthayan, Khmer, Chinese, and Indian art, culminating in a magnificent structure that embodies spiritual themes through detailed hand-carved panels and sculptures.

The construction of the Sanctuary of Truth began in 1981, envisioned by Thai businessman Lek Viriyaphan. It is a monumental, ongoing project that continues to this day, reflecting a dedication to preserving ancient craftsmanship and wisdom for future generations. While much of the main structure is complete, intricate carvings and restoration work are continuously carried out, making it a living museum of traditional art and philosophy.

Visitors to the Sanctuary of Truth can explore the magnificent wooden structure both inside and out, observing the detailed hand-carved sculptures that depict scenes from mythology and philosophy. The experience often includes opportunities to watch craftsmen at work, demonstrating traditional carving techniques. Beyond the main temple, guests can enjoy surrounding activities such as elephant rides, horse riding, or traditional boat trips, offering a diverse cultural and recreational visit.
The architectural style of the Sanctuary of Truth is a deliberate blend of traditional Thai, Khmer, Indian, and Chinese influences, designed to represent the diverse roots of human civilization and spiritual understanding. Each carving and structural element reflects ancient Eastern philosophies, universal truths, and the cultural heritage of the region. This grand wooden edifice serves as a powerful symbol of artistic devotion and a reminder of humanity's continuous quest for spiritual enlightenment and cultural preservation.
